Containment and Extraction

Our team uses advanced equipment to contain the affected area, preventing further damage and exposure to contaminants. We then extract the water using specialized pumps and vacuums, ensuring that every last drop is removed. This process typically takes 30 minutes to an hour, depending on the size of the affected area.

Moisture Detection and Drying

We use specialized equipment to detect and measure moisture levels in your office building, identifying areas that need attention. We then develop a customized drying plan, using high-velocity fans and dehumidifiers to dry out the affected areas. This process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.

Cleaning and Disinfecting

Once the affected area is dry, our team thoroughly cleans and disinfects it, removing any remaining water and contaminants. We use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to ensure that your office building is safe and healthy for you and your staff to work in.

Final Inspection and Restoration

Our team conducts a final inspection to ensure that all affected areas are dry and safe. We then work with you to restore your office building to its former glory, including repairing damaged walls and ceilings, and replacing any water-damaged materials.

Office Building Water Damage Restoration Cost in Glendale, WI

The cost of Office Building Water Damage Rest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Glendale, WI. These estimates are based on real-world costs and are intended to provide a general idea of what you can expect to pay.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Containment and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of water damage, and equipment needed.
Moisture Detection and Drying $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and equipment needed.
Cleaning and Dis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ning solutions needed, and equipment used.
Final Inspection and Restoration $1,000 – $3,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and equipment needed.
Repairing Damaged Walls and Ceilings $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of materials needed, and equipment used.

How do I prevent water damage in my office building?

Preventing water damage in your office building is easier than you think. Regular maintenance, such as inspecting your roof and gutters, can help prevent water damage. Also, installing a sump pump and backup power source can also help prevent water damage in the event of a power outage.
